Coulson Oil Forms New Real Estate Company

NORTH LITTLE ROCK, Ark. -- Coulson Oil Co., one of the Southwest's largest independent distributors of motor fuels, formed a new real estate company called Coulson Real Estate Group LLC.

"Real estate has always played a large role in the growth and operation of our company. In fact, one of the reasons our founder, Ray Coulson, started the company was due to his passion for real estate," said Mike Coulson, chairman of Coulson Oil Co. "The board of directors and I felt that by the formation of Coulson Real Estate Group, we can place increased focus on the acquisition and development of current and future holdings."

Currently, the company has a real estate portfolio of properties throughout Arkansas. Coulson Real Estate Group will be charged with building the value of the company's holdings, as well as taking on the management, development and financing of present and new real estate acquisitions.

Eddie Martin, currently Coulson Oil's senior vice president and general counsel, has been named president of the Coulson Real Estate Group. He joined the company in 2002, and has had primary responsibility for handling the company's real estate operations.

The company's initial real estate efforts were targeted at the purchase of property for new retail motor fuel outlets. Approximately 100 of its current property holdings are used for convenience store operations. However, with changes seen in the fueling and c-store industries over the past few decades, it has become more important than ever to ensure these properties are being used to their best advantage, according to the company.

"What we are seeing now is that some of our holdings may have a better use than serving as a c-store location," Martin said. "We will be looking at the possibility of selling some properties to Coulson Oil dealers, while facilities at other locations we hold may be rebuilt to meet state-of-the-art convenience store standards. Our plan is to look at all our properties and determine what is in the best interest for the company, dealers and ultimately, our c-store customers."

Martin said immediate plans for Coulson Real Estate Group include the sale of several existing properties, which could be used for other purposes. The new company will also be looking at the possibility of rebuilding current stores. Long term, Coulson Real Estate Group will be investigating ways of diversifying holdings to include non-gas real estate properties, with the goal of rebalancing its current portfolio by property type, investment size and risk profile.

Additionally, the company will be looking at acquisition of new properties outside of Arkansas.

North Little Rock-based Coulson Oil, founded in 1969, is a multi-branded distributor of gasoline and diesel fuels in Arkansas, Tennessee and Oklahoma. Through a network of more than 200 dealers, Coulson Oil markets branded fuels from Shell Oil, ConocoPhillips, Valero Energy and Sinclair Oil, as well as unbranded fuel. Its various operating companies include Seahawk Transport, a 24/7 motor fuel carrier; CP Services & Testing, providing maintenance and similar services to both Coulson Oil dealers and other gasoline retailers; and the SuperStop Coop, which establishes relationships with vendors to provide products and services to Coulson dealers at negotiated prices.
